The Biodistribution and Potential Diagnostic Ability of 18F FACBC in Patients With Head and Neck, Breast, and Prostate Cancer
NA trial testing novel PET tracer FACBC in Breast Cancer in 20 participants. Completed in 6 April 2017.

Who can join
18 and older, any sex, with Breast Cancer or Head and Neck Cancer.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.
Sponsor's own description
See where the dye-like material (FACBC) goes in your body and how long it stays in your body. See how much of the dye-like material is picked up by your tumor Compare the FACBC pictures with other pictures (such as FDG PET scan) that were obtained as part of your standard imaging evaluation.
